Are you passionate about business, the economy and influencing legislative change? Join a policy committee! Policy volunteers work together to identify gaps in legislation and tackle emerging business issues, make recommendations for change, and meet with government leaders and policy makers to advocate on behalf of business. Policy committees will meet once per month on a Thursday afternoon from September until April, excepting December.
